La Paz: Mountain Chacaltaya and Moon Valley Guided Day Tour

Highlights

  • Hike the Andes mountain range 5400m
  • Change of ecosystems in the Luna Valley
  • Going through almost the whole city
  • Discover the different types of social classes

Description

Located 27 km from downtown La Paz, Chacaltaya Mountain stands tall at 5400 m.a.s.l. Once home to the highest ski slopes in the world, it now offers a breathtaking viewpoint of the Mountain range, vibrant colored lagoons, La Paz City, Lake Titicaca, and the Bolivian highlands. Embark on a memorable mountain hike, taking in the spectacular sights at this lofty altitude. While the ascent can be relatively easy with little snow, the combination of high altitude and limited oxygen makes it challenging. Rest assured, you can always return to the car if you start feeling unwell.

After exploring Chacaltaya Mountain, our transport will take us to the enchanting Valley of the Moon. This journey typically takes around 1 hour and 30 minutes, assuming the path is clear.

Situated approximately 39 km from Chacaltaya Mountain, Moon Valley is a descent into an eroded area with clay obelisks and occasional sightings of the typical highland animal, the “viscacha.” Immerse yourself in the otherworldly atmosphere and feel as if you are on the moon itself.

Once our visit to the Valley of the Moon concludes, we will head back to the vibrant center of La Paz. Some passengers may choose to utilize the opportunity to explore other parts of the city along the way, following the guide’s recommendations, of course.

La Paz: Mountain Bike Down the World’s Most Dangerous Road

Highlights

  • Take in incredible Andean scenery seen over 64 kilometers of dramatic descent
  • Ride on one of the best bikes in Bolivia, maintained after every ride by highly qualified mechanics
  • Stay safe with your highly trained, knowledgeable, and fun guides
  • Finish at an amazing animal sanctuary 3500 meters below where you started
  • Rest easy knowing your guides have the best safety record in Bolivia, using international safety standards

Description

Experience the thrilling adventure of conquering the infamous “World’s Most Dangerous Road”, also known as “Death Road” or “Camino de la Muerte”, in South America. With our highly-trained guides and mechanics, who have been riding this road for over 20 years, your safety and comfort are our top priorities.

The journey begins from La Paz, Bolivia, where you will drive up to the wind-swept La Cumbre, located at an altitude of 4700 meters. From here, you will enjoy breathtaking views of snow-covered peaks before embarking on a rapid descent along a twisting asphalt road. As you make your way through the mountain peaks, you will encounter llamas, alpacas, and quaint villages, providing ample opportunities to stop for refreshments, photos, and rest breaks. Take your time to soak in the awe-inspiring scenery of towering cliff faces, dramatic drops, and lush vegetation before proceeding to the next exhilarating section of the ride.

Continuing further down, you will enter the jungle and face the most challenging part of the journey. This narrow dirt road, famously carved into the side of the mountain, presents a thrilling descent of 2000 meters. Ride through mist, low clouds, and dust as the temperature rises and the road becomes dustier. By the time you reach Yolosa at the bottom, you will be hot, dirty, and filled with a sense of accomplishment for conquering Death Road fearlessly.

After this adrenaline-pumping adventure, a visit to the La Senda Verde Animal Refuge awaits. Enjoy a delicious buffet lunch amidst magnificent scenery and witness the diverse range of animals inhabiting the Yungas region. From monkeys and spectacled bears to capibaras and various bird species, the refuge is a sanctuary for rescued animals. Your visit contributes to the incredible work they do in combating the black market trade in wildlife.

Countless riders have declared this experience as their best in Bolivia. Even if you have limited biking experience, our skilled guides, top-notch bikes, and coaching will ensure your safe and amazing journey. Rest assured that there is no other downhill ride in the world quite like this one.

La Paz: Death Road Guided Mountain Biking Tour with Lunch

Highlights

  • Double suspension bike
  • RMX Rocky Mountain with hydraulic brakes
  • Lunch and some snacks included
  • English speaking guide
  • Small groups 7 people + 1 guide

Description

The mountain biking tour to Coroico starts early in the morning from La Paz city. Then go by transport to “La Cumbre” (1hr. from La Paz), which is the starting point at 4.700 m.a.s.l.

TOUR DESCRIPTION

Leg 1: This is a 22 km downhill on asphalt (tarmac) road. At the police checkpoint (after 45 min.) all tourists pay Bs. 50 for the entrance to the national park. This first section is for you to develop confidence and get used to the bike. Do not worry, the safety van is always behind the group and we have stops for water, photos and bike checks.

Leg2: “Death Road” about 10 Km. always in a compact group (safety first!!!) and also snack time with chocolate, fruit, and more.

Leg 3: About 32 Km. it starts with a waterfall splash!! Finally, the end of the tour is in Yolosa, so the next stop is in a hotel with showers, a swimming pool, and a lunch as well. At approximately 05:00 p.m. it´s time to go back to La Paz driving through the new road.

BIKE DESCRIPTION
Bike: Full suspension bike with hydraulic disk brakes.

Charquini Mountain 5390 m.

Highlights

  • Hike in the altiplano more than 4100 m
  • Round trip transportation including stops
  • Admire the Andes Mountains & Altiplano

Description

Charquini is a snowy destination located 39 km from La Paz city. Situated at an elevation of 5390 meters above sea level, Charquini is part of the Andes Royal Range, close to Huayna Potosi (6088 m.a.s.l.) and Chacaltaya (5400 m.a.s.l.). Its stunning landscapes on the Bolivian high plateau make it a wonderful place to visit, including beautiful colored lagoons. Visitors can also encounter wildlife such as llamas, alpacas, viscachas, and various bird species.

The journey to Charquini begins at 08:00 from La Paz city and takes approximately one and a half hours. Upon arrival by car, we embark on a hike that lasts another one and a half hours to reach the snowy peak. Once there, our guide will provide an explanation and we can fully enjoy the snow. Afterward, we return to the transportation and head back to La Paz city, arriving around 18:00.

La Paz: Tiwanaku Archeological Site Full-Day Tour

Highlights

  • Explore the most important archaeological site in Bolivia
  • Learn about pre-Incan cultures
  • See ancient architecture and carvings

Description

Your day will begin with a convenient pickup from your hotel in central La Paz, around 7:30 AM. From there, you will embark on a journey to Tiwanaku, the most significant archaeological site in Bolivia.

Situated near the southern edge of Lake Titicaca, Tiwanaku, also known as Tiahuanaco, was once the bustling capital of a formidable pre-Inca civilization. This powerful civilization ruled over the Andean region from 500 AD to 900 AD. The Incas themselves regarded Tiwanaku as a sacred site, believing it to be the place where their god Viracocha emerged from the depths of Lake Titicaca.

Accompanied by a knowledgeable guide, you will have the opportunity to explore this awe-inspiring location. Marvel at the grandeur of the various temples, the pyramid, and the symbolic gates that still grace the site. Additionally, you’ll encounter enigmatic rock carvings featuring faces that bear an intriguing resemblance to extraterrestrial beings.

After an insightful tour, you will be transported back to La Paz, where you can reflect on the wonders you experienced at Tiwanaku.
